According to their forecasts, Russia’s economic growth is likely to slow this year, and Western sanctions will make life even more difficult for ordinary citizens. In their opinion, sanctions could be tightened, especially if Joe Biden is re-elected as US President in November.

Russia has already survived the impact of Western sanctions, but there may be a turning point in the US presidential elections in November… The West is likely to continue to support Ukraine, and if Joe Biden is re-elected, sanctions against Russia could be tightened, the article notes.

According to media sources, people in Russia are currently continuing with their normal lives, but this strategy is “completely unsustainable” and the fundamental growth factors on which the economy is built are under threat. If Trump is not re-elected, these problems will become more apparent.

The West could deal a potentially devastating blow to the Russian economy by extending sanctions to Russian oil and other metal goods, which account for about 20% of the country’s income.

The standard of living in Russia is already falling. Civilian infrastructure is collapsing, partly due to the costs of military operations. Inflation is also high. When Russians realize that Putin’s promised path to victory has not been as successful as expected, mass protests are possible.
